LA Restaurant and Wine Bar Entering Little Italy - Eater San Diego

"Zinqué Restaurant & Wine Bar, whose locations in Venice, West Hollywood, and Newport Beach serve a European menu at brunch, lunch, and dinner that ranges from quiche and panini to cheese and charcuterie, whole grilled fish, and steak frites, will open in a nearly 3,000-square-foot space at the corner of Kettner and Hawthorn in Little Italy." - Candice Woo

New review- We had 6 people to eat dinner at this restaurant. And we ordered a bunch of different things. I had a slow cook 3 hours chicken leg, the sauce is delicious, but the chicken is kind of dry. My friends foods look okay, but the fries and steak look too much fries with little bit steak. For that price, I don’t think it’s worthy. All the appetizers are so so, and desserts are fine, not great as well. I think their brunch are better than dinner. Previous review - We love this restaurant. It is not at the very center of Little Italy so it’s not that crowded and loud, we like it. The foods here are pretty nice. We came here for brunch, I enjoyed my Avocado Toast with prosciutto on it, so yummy. The drinks are good and service is very nice as well. Previous review- This is definitely a super cute place in Little Italy San Diego. My husband and I try to find a place has both coffee and cocktails, and plus… coffee cocktails. We found this French restaurant, it’s a beautiful open space, listed a big wine menu. I had an Almond Milk latte, and surprisingly they made it as good as the real milk, the almond milk foam is steamed so well. My husband said his espresso martini is one of the best he had so far, so he ordered a second one. We will go back to try their food someday soon, it seems a very popular place. And the service is patient and nice.

Great little spot on Kettner Blvd. in northern Little Italy. Wasn’t really busy (Thursday around 10:00am) so we just walked in sat ourselves and enjoyed our surroundings. Not a big menu, but a very good menu. The breakfast sandwich and the soft scramble with salmon were super tasty. The ambiance and atmosphere was great and their coffee (i drink it black) was one of the best cups I’ve had in downtown San Diego. Off the beaten path a tad but worth a try and visit!

friendly, attentive staff and good food. the leek quiche came with an absurd amount of fries, but the quiche itself was delicious. my boyfriend ordered a half rotisserie chicken with scalloped potatoes, and his potatoes hit the spot. both of our lattes were delicious and the barista tried both drinks before serving them, which shows that they are committed to quality. we will definitely be back.
